Maintenance Tips of MG 90005428 Screw for MG750/MG GS/MG ZS/RX5/MG HS/RX8
- First, select the right MG screw (OE# 90005428) for your MG750, MG GS, MG ZS, RX5, MG HS, or RX8. Using the wrong size can lead to loose connections.
- Before installation, clean the screw holes to ensure proper thread engagement. This helps the MG screw hold tightly.
- Apply a small amount of anti - seize compound on the threads of the MG screw. It makes future removal easier and prevents corrosion.
- Tighten the MG screw gradually in a criss - cross pattern if multiple screws are used. This distributes the pressure evenly.
- After tightening, check the torque of the MG screw with a torque wrench. The correct torque ensures reliable performance.
Warning: Over - tightening the MG screw (OE# 90005428) can strip the threads or damage the parts. Follow the recommended torque values.
